Mr. SHANKS. These items of increases and decreases, as well as the regular estimates, will be explained in detail as we now take up each paragraph as appearing in the Budget estimates.

SALARIES OF MEMBERS, DELEGATES, AND RESIDENT COMMISSIONER FROM PUERTO RICO

The estimates for 1945 for "Salaries of Members" calls for $4,385.000, the same as appropriated for the current fiscal year 1944, and is based on 435 Members, 2 Delegates and 1 Resident Commissioner, or a total of 438 at $10,000 each and $5,000 additional compensation for the Speaker of the House of Representatives.

MILEAGE OF MEMBERS, DELEGATES, AND RESIDENT COMMISSIONER FROM

PUERTO RICO

The next item is for "Mileage of Representatives, the Delegates from Hawaii and Alaska, and the Resident Commissioner from Puerto Rico," and the amount estimated for 1945 is $171,000, the same as appropriated for the fiscal year 1914.

SALARIES OF OFFICERS AND EMPLOYEES OF TH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ES

OFFICE OF THE SPEAKER

The estimates for 1945 amount to $13,500, the same as appropriated for 1944, there being no change whatsoever in the paragraph.

THE SPEAKER'S TABLE

The estimates for the employees at the Speaker's table for the fiscal year 1945 amount to $14,740, or a decrease of $660 from the amount appropriated for 1944. The former messenger to the Speaker's table, who was receiving $660 additional so long as the postion was held by him, was appointed to another position and accordingly this additional sum is now being eliminated from the bill.

Mr. PLOESER. What is the difference in compensation?

Mr. SHANKS. He was receiving $1,740 and there was added $660, or a total of $2,400, as long as the position was held by the incumbent. His successor drops back to the basic salary of $1,740, so we eliminate that extra amount, making a saving of $660.

CHAPLAIN

The salary of the Chaplain of the House, total $2,500, remains the same for the fiscal year 1945.
